Workplace Safety in the Foodservice Industry

Workplace Safety in the Foodservice Industry is one of a series of Culinary Arts books developed to support the training of students and apprentices in BC’s foodservice and hospitality industry. Although created with the Professional Cook, Baker and Meatcutter programs in mind, these have been designed as a modular series, and therefore can be used to support a wide variety of programs that offer training in foodservice skills.

Working Safely with Ladders

This PowerPoint presentation describes the four basic components of ladder safety. It includes information on deciding when to use a ladder, inspecting ladders, setting up ladders, and climbing ladders.
